‘Dalle Khursani’ a highly pungent Capsicum is primarily cultivated for decades in the hilly region of North Eastern Himalayan States. All the studied ‘Dalle Khursani’ populations were found to be polyploid with 2n = 48 chromosomes. Allopolyploid nature of Dalle Khursani populations was revealed by gametic chromosome analysis. EMA method was used for chromosome analysis. Fluorescence banding revealed CMA + ve DAPI-ve bands were associated with nucleolar chromosomes. Genomic DNA analysis within the populations revealed their homology.
